The reviews are highly opinionated and based on individual perspective, and there is no way for Glassdoor to verify whether the statements made are true or false. Everyone has their own opinion of what those ratings should stand for. There are no real guidelines that Glassdoor gives users to decide which star rating is satisfactory for their situation – which mean all reviews are based on opinion and individual perspective. Dozens of glowing reviews were written by people who listed their title as managers. SAP shared with the Journal an Aug. 22 email sent by its “employer brand” team that asked employees to post Glassdoor reviews and mentioned the annual award. “It is our ambition to position SAP as one of the best employers in the U.S.—and you play an important role in making this happen,” the email said. We compared the number of reviews to the number of employees two ways. First, we used Glassdoor’s estimated number of employees per employer. For the 531 companies in our sample, the average number of reviews per average number of employees was 3.4%, and the median number of reviews per median number of employees was 4.5% using the Glassdoor employee data. To validate these estimates, we took a subset of 327 publicly listed companies in our sample that listed their total employment in Securities and Exchange Commission filings.
